Real Flight Simulation – F6F Hellcat Service Pack

After the long awaited delay we're pleased to announce the release of F6F Service Pack.

With exceptional customer feedback the service pack couldn't have been so thorough without your help.

However the free scenery objects and additional paint schemes never made it to the service pack, please note that these are being worked on as we speak and should be made available shortly to those that have purchased the Hellcat.

We hope to have addressed all problems that was encountered initially through our forums and also via email. Below is a list of fixes and additional model enhancements.

- Glass texture improvements
- Flaps Indicator correction
- Pitot Heater correction
- Wing Fold Lever implementation
- Anti-Detonation lever and cooling system implementation.
- Trim wheel correction
- Pop-up Radio correction
- VC Radio correction
- Bank indicator is currently stuck on 45deg when flying straight and level (F6F-3)
- Cabin Light Switch Implementation
- Gun doors lever implementation
- F6F-3 tacho correction
- VC functionality with levers and switches for a host of systems
- New and improved PDF simulation manual
- Paint kit
- Landing Gear lever
- Wheel chocks now appear when parking brake is set
- New effects
- Anti-detonation implemented

And last but not least the 'DOA'. The DOA offers the seasoned simmer the opportunity to manage the engine, However – if you choose to fly full real, pay special attention to your gauges. There's a more detailed indication on how to manage your R2800 engine within the simulation PDF.

In order to install the update you will be needing to download the new installer, which contains all of the above and also the full model pack.

To download the update, login to your customer area and re-download the large installer.
